Shape the future of Social networking with WordPress: Join Project Midnight Sun! The next generation platform for community building with WordPress!

BuddyDev

Search

Replies

  • Keymaster
    (BuddyDev Team)
    Posts: 25373

    Hi,
    Here is my reply to each of the issue

    1) In each tab page in the back-end, Memberium metaboxes (content protection and custom codes) are displayed as if it were an actual WP page. However, they don’t work. I would like to request that you allow Memberium to control access to BUPTCP’s custom tabs as well. It would be invaluable.

    You are right. It is a bug in memberium. They should not show their meta boxes on a private post type. Please let them know the above line and ask them to either disable it for private post types or ask them if they provide a hook to disable it. There is not much we can do it on our part.

    2) Buddyboss has the ability to show certain sidebar widgets only on the profile page sidebar. However, when BUPTCP is activated, Memberium’s content protection metabox doesn’t work any more for these standard WP widgets. It obviously works if I deactivate BUPTCP.

    As soon as Memberium’s metabox membership levels or tags settings are changed, the widget remains permanently visible or invisible regardless of the metabox settings. At that point, the only way to fix the problem is removing the widget and adding it again without touching any Memberium metabox settings.

    I would like to ask that – if possible – you make Memberium fully compatible with BUPTCP. I got in touch with Memberium support and they replied that they would like to integrate with you but cannot make it happen on their own. The details of their reply are following:

    I am not sure how memberium protects the metabox, so unable to help unless they point you/us to a hook for the same.
    I have worked with memberium in past on a client’s site and working with it(developer customizations) has been a nightmare. The code is obfuscated(which is against the spirit of WordPress & Opensource) and that makes it very difficult for us to understand or assist with it.

    If they can point to relevant hooks and how their hiding works, I will be glad to add the compatibility.

    Reply from memberium support:

    That integration is a premium plugin that was done by BuddyDev, not by us.

    My educated guess is that their code doesn’t use the standard filters when loading, and just pulls the pages and widgets in for display.

    The access control metabox you’re seeing added automatically to any/all pages that get displayed on the front-end, but it being on the page doesn’t guarantee that the other plugin won’t bypass and load/display it directly.

    I would recommend raising this with them.

    The good news is that I DO suspect it’s an easy fix on their end, if it’s something they want to support.

    If there’s anything we can do to support them we’re happy to, it’s just not a code base we have access to, are familiar with, or have any control over.

    Please give them a copy of our plugin(It is GPL licensed and there are no restrictions) and ask them if they can point what is wrong? We will be more than happy to change. We do use ‘the_content’ filter at one point but if this is causing issue, it seem there is something very wrong with their restrictions then.

    Since their code is obfuscated and restricted, Please give them a copy of our plugin and let me know their feedback for change.

    Thank you
    Brajesh

  • Keymaster
    (BuddyDev Team)
    Posts: 25373
    This reply has been marked as private.
  • Keymaster
    (BuddyDev Team)
    Posts: 25373

    Hi Salvatore,
    Welcome to BuddyDev support forums.

    We have received your message and I am posting that in my next private reply(using private reply to protect the privacy of message), Please let me know if you want that to be public.

    I will be posting my reply after that.

    Thank you
    Brajehs

  • Keymaster
    (BuddyDev Team)
    Posts: 25373

    Hi,
    Thank you for using the plugin.

    Please visit Users’s profile->Account and you will find the privacy tab there.

    Regards
    Brajesh

  • Keymaster
    (BuddyDev Team)
    Posts: 25373

    Hi Omar,
    I am sorry, The code will not work with BuddyBoss. It does not matter at what priority you attach it as they first generate markup for their enabled buttons and then append then buttons hooked at ‘bp_member_header_actions’.

    Please get in touch with BuddyBoss support and see if they can help. You might need a different hook.

    Regards
    Brajesh

  • Keymaster
    (BuddyDev Team)
    Posts: 25373
    Brajesh Singh on in reply to: How to make payment #38984

    Hi Siddharth,
    Thank you for your interest in our products. I am sorry for the inconvenience.

    At the moment our volume from India is very low and we are not using a domestic payment processor.

    Please have a look at the following doc for how to purchase from India.

    https://buddydev.com/docs/accountmembership/how-do-i-get-a-premium-membership-from-india/

    Regards
    Brajesh

  • Keymaster
    (BuddyDev Team)
    Posts: 25373
  • Keymaster
    (BuddyDev Team)
    Posts: 25373

    Hi Sandra,
    Thank you.

    Can you please check my previous message and allow me to access the WordPress dashboard/plugin editor.

    Thank you
    Brajesh

  • Keymaster
    (BuddyDev Team)
    Posts: 25373

    Hi Bob,
    I am sorry, I did not reply earlier.

    Yes, I am still planning to rewrite it. It may not work for existing multi fields based condition as we are moving from the field id to values. Other than that, everything else will work.

    I will try to implement an upgrader for the existing multi fields based condition but I am unable to guarantee it it currently.

    Thank you
    Brajesh

  • Keymaster
    (BuddyDev Team)
    Posts: 25373

    Hi Anders,
    You are right. The option is not in the released version. It is in my development version. I will push it within 24 hours on wp.org and will let you know.

    Regards
    Brajesh